#cbfbda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cbfbda is composed of 79.6% red, 98.4%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 138.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 89%. #cbfbda color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#97f7b5.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#cbfbda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cbfbda has RGB values of R:203, G:251,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 13368282.

Shades and Tints of #cbfbda
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#effef4 is the lightest one.
